The Yamaha TW 225 was a Air Cooled, Four Stroke, Single Cylinder, SOHC Trial motorcycle produced by Yamaha in 2001.

Engine

A 71.1mm bore x 71.1mm stroke result in a displacement of just 223.0 cubic centimeters.

Drive

The bike has a 6-Speed transmission. Power was moderated via the Wet multi-plate.

Chassis

It came with a 130/80-18 front tire and a 180/80-14 rear tire. Stopping was achieved via Single disc 220 mm in the front and a Drum 110 mm in the rear. The front suspension was a Telescopic fork while the rear was equipped with a Swingarm. The wheelbase was 52.2 inches (1326 mm) long.
